Microsoft OneNote
Microsoft OneNote is a versatile digital notebook application that allows users to capture, organize, and share notes across multiple devices. Offering a freeform canvas, it supports text, handwritten notes, drawings, audio recordings, and embedded media, making it an excellent tool for students, professionals, and anyone needing a flexible note-taking solution. by Microsoft

KeepNote
KeepNote is a versatile note-taking application designed for organizing information in a hierarchical structure. Available on Windows, Linux, and macOS X, it features robust organization tools, including a tree-like outline, wiki-like linking, and support for embedded files and images. Although discontinued, its local storage and rich features make it a compelling tool for detailed note-taking and research. by Matt Rasmussen

Pros & Cons Comparison

Microsoft OneNote
Pros
- Flexible freeform canvas for creative note-taking.
- Excellent handwriting recognition and stylus support.
- Powerful search including handwritten notes and text in images.
- Seamless cross-platform synchronization.
- Deep integration with the Microsoft Office ecosystem.
- Robust features for embedding various media types.
Cons
- Freeform nature can lead to disorganization if not managed carefully.
- Interface can feel slightly different across various platforms.
- May experience performance issues with very large or complex notebooks on some devices.

KeepNote
Pros
- Excellent hierarchical organization for complex information.
- Wiki-like linking facilitates building a connected knowledge base.
- Supports rich text formatting and embedded files/images.
- Highly portable due to its open file structure.
- Notes are stored locally, offering strong data privacy.
Cons
- Project is discontinued, no future updates.
- Lacks built-in cloud synchronization.
- No mobile applications available.
- User interface is somewhat dated.
- Requires manual backup process.
